Life Safety Rope is used for which of the following?

Explanation:
Life Safety Rope is built for operations involving people—protecting rescuers and victims during access, ascent/descent, and support in both emergencies and training. Its purpose is to safely raise, lower, and secure someone, using proper anchor systems and rope techniques to manage hazards during rescue scenarios. It isn’t just for securing gear, nor is it limited to rope climbing or water rescue; those uses require different rope types or equipment designed for those specific tasks. Focusing on keeping humans safe in rescue operations is what makes life safety rope the appropriate choice.
